diff options
author | Vlastimil Babka <caster@gentoo.org> | 2010-02-11 23:03:14 +0000 |
---|---|---|
committer | Vlastimil Babka <caster@gentoo.org> | 2010-02-11 23:03:14 +0000 |
commit | f9715299c09b859227c505f0d2999fd53fd7e4d8 (patch) | |
tree | e4bbfedbfb9c9e49d3c70444b815b007faeee07f /media-video | |
parent | Add ~amd64-linux/~x86-linux keywords (diff) | |
download | historical-f9715299c09b859227c505f0d2999fd53fd7e4d8.tar.gz historical-f9715299c09b859227c505f0d2999fd53fd7e4d8.tar.bz2 historical-f9715299c09b859227c505f0d2999fd53fd7e4d8.zip |
Remove java5 and java6 flags and cleanup per bug #304639.
Package-Manager: portage-2.2_rc62/cvs/Linux x86_64
Diffstat (limited to 'media-video')
-rw-r--r-- | media-video/projectx/ChangeLog | 9 | ||||
-rw-r--r-- | media-video/projectx/Manifest | 8 | ||||
-rw-r--r-- | media-video/projectx/projectx-0.90.4.00-r3.ebuild | 8 | ||||
-rw-r--r-- | media-video/projectx/projectx-0.90.4.00_p26.ebuild | 30 | ||||
-rw-r--r-- | media-video/projectx/projectx-0.90.4.00_p32.ebuild | 31 |
5 files changed, 34 insertions, 52 deletions
diff --git a/media-video/projectx/ChangeLog b/media-video/projectx/ChangeLog index c58034d24ab2..e5c1aee01f9b 100644 --- a/media-video/projectx/ChangeLog +++ b/media-video/projectx/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for media-video/projectx -#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/projectx/ChangeLog,v 1.33 2009/10/08 18:29:21 billie Exp $ +#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/media-video/projectx/ChangeLog,v 1.34 2010/02/11 23:03:14 caster Exp $ + + 11 Feb 2010; Vlastimil Babka <caster@gentoo.org> + projectx-0.90.4.00-r3.ebuild, projectx-0.90.4.00_p26.ebuild, + projectx-0.90.4.00_p32.ebuild: + Remove java5 and java6 flags and cleanup per bug #304639. *projectx-0.90.4.00_p32 (08 Oct 2009) diff --git a/media-video/projectx/Manifest b/media-video/projectx/Manifest index 3fad73a862b7..27edb38abd37 100644 --- a/media-video/projectx/Manifest +++ b/media-video/projectx/Manifest @@ -10,9 +10,9 @@ DIST projectx-patches-0.90.4.00-r3.tbz2 1394 RMD160 05e2c2936bcbbcb3344ca22ae037 DIST projectx-patches-0.90.4.00-r4.tbz2 1394 RMD160 05e2c2936bcbbcb3344ca22ae0379e9e1d33a37c SHA1 e73aa3bc14e8015029ceeacbc2928b551b9354aa SHA256 57cb89ac50fc6418ae30cc68a4003fc3cc2c0eace8c7f9e108a863a1424fcde6 DIST projectx-patches-0.90.4.00_p26.tbz2 1020 RMD160 0b6405e1b3191b855422ca1b047197593233d2c6 SHA1 cc4c1f157f9687295d0e3aa6dee0632ac2aea81c SHA256 5c9564f824cc4cbc56dd0bc6a5f75112e5833cefd45e89974cfa7f97bde23000 DIST projectx-patches-0.90.4.00_p32.tbz2 1020 RMD160 0b6405e1b3191b855422ca1b047197593233d2c6 SHA1 cc4c1f157f9687295d0e3aa6dee0632ac2aea81c SHA256 5c9564f824cc4cbc56dd0bc6a5f75112e5833cefd45e89974cfa7f97bde23000 -EBUILD projectx-0.90.4.00-r3.ebuild 3056 RMD160 7015a2c20c4eb33d9fbb073e37ee8bae16980fc0 SHA1 6bd3199481623c6b2681373e9c80d04a31ef052e SHA256 3972757a08c08226cd5967f03cd74abc11118dacd801fb03e905b81569a47077 +EBUILD projectx-0.90.4.00-r3.ebuild 3056 RMD160 53d544393c9a667438d92b9cf94f70140a95d011 SHA1 b10c6a79c4e78153fdf1c983192cb7c9b43e59e5 SHA256 edbf4bd453827a532114feeab78f97ebb3463454e4fc0ee8fac209772ed84220 EBUILD projectx-0.90.4.00-r4.ebuild 3107 RMD160 b002678fc6a034701e56a390f332c20e6ce247a7 SHA1 fe9f44f44db7ffb9539f36ae704329a27a19bc6a SHA256 d9abf89f5221ed1991b7775fa0fd419be84342c9243b2b316ea39fdaedc75088 -EBUILD projectx-0.90.4.00_p26.ebuild 3613 RMD160 1e3b20bee182c0f27a169c2554aa22196281b77c SHA1 05870cc5b7d6f7c267f472236b039856f400a8a2 SHA256 c6650f66e7530bdbbe41dbab837e3b335f4f880e7619a4c4bd5158687b0184a7 -EBUILD projectx-0.90.4.00_p32.ebuild 3483 RMD160 78302d339fb56966bebaadf038241605815696e5 SHA1 cacf7439da135fc1e1e6411c029b8ec56cfc2dd3 SHA256 ed34d7cd18f4a3e7daccc55f636e3b28d9992a4ed14e46db72e256d9fec4affb -MISC ChangeLog 3768 RMD160 9e616b4bda769340270be22f335ab8bb6d992be9 SHA1 5659534a3f971e2aa18527fd60118c5231129610 SHA256 dc48f327327e73259d3526736543e046c901151b25ef4cd7699222fb93f31f54 +EBUILD projectx-0.90.4.00_p26.ebuild 3147 RMD160 ff2a93509ed8c0f7b0a9cf7cb0dabc89ac60e445 SHA1 ac7012d5a57c67f8215f834180a930ac1d6c205e SHA256 4448e144db5c17ea3cda7b2fbc1b2f2e63d64a996e696e54496d051bc4a3b77b +EBUILD projectx-0.90.4.00_p32.ebuild 3039 RMD160 6ac160d5c53e4e4d580ad3024acec8408168e9ae SHA1 8b26a786fb8094257df78e1d14bda127c4aaa4f2 SHA256 35e4571ffe6097f6bdda0396a1667b50e1b2dac3c454fa7440eb890123e90426 +MISC ChangeLog 3976 RMD160 d0ade03b4492186e9510c6281bea66556565b235 SHA1 0af64bca40dda96158c50e3d3f5c195f53aec193 SHA256 47382e7676c5416170efc78657405efd4d6603bfe4d4f1d7f11d0acd6d732d12 MISC metadata.xml 648 RMD160 08c95d7596fa4b9c15412d618a8776a2c4a4b4d5 SHA1 08509daf9306b49f7753133791b3618724f76e1a SHA256 02f9b720480dac25585b7c9e5f8c39caf0560bef841f75788215f2dbc28a3940 diff --git a/media-video/projectx/projectx-0.90.4.00-r3.ebuild b/media-video/projectx/projectx-0.90.4.00-r3.ebuild index 3c54b18bd25f..ee68881a30bc 100644 --- a/media-video/projectx/projectx-0.90.4.00-r3.ebuild +++ b/media-video/projectx/projectx-0.90.4.00-r3.ebuild @@ -1,6 +1,6 @@ -# Copyright 1999-2008 Gentoo Foundation +# Copyright 1999-2010 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/projectx/projectx-0.90.4.00-r3.ebuild,v 1.7 2008/04/03 14:50:02 ranger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/projectx/projectx-0.90.4.00-r3.ebuild,v 1.8 2010/02/11 23:03:14 caster Exp $ inherit eutils toolchain-funcs java-pkg-2 java-ant-2 @@ -28,10 +28,10 @@ IUSE="X doc source mmx" COMMON_DEP="dev-java/commons-net X? ( =dev-java/browserlauncher2-1* )" -RDEPEND=">=virtual/jre-1.4 +RDEPEND=">=virtual/jre-1.5 ${COMMON_DEP}" -DEPEND=">=virtual/jdk-1.4 +DEPEND=">=virtual/jdk-1.5 ${COMMON_DEP} app-arch/unzip dev-java/ant-core diff --git a/media-video/projectx/projectx-0.90.4.00_p26.ebuild b/media-video/projectx/projectx-0.90.4.00_p26.ebuild index 7003d248c677..2f7647f571a1 100644 --- a/media-video/projectx/projectx-0.90.4.00_p26.ebuild +++ b/media-video/projectx/projectx-0.90.4.00_p26.ebuild @@ -1,6 +1,8 @@ -# Copyright 1999-2008 Gentoo Foundation +# Copyright 1999-2010 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/projectx/projectx-0.90.4.00_p26.ebuild,v 1.1 2008/12/06 22:46:22 sbriesen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/projectx/projectx-0.90.4.00_p26.ebuild,v 1.2 2010/02/11 23:03:14 caster Exp $ + +JAVA_PKG_IUSE="doc source" inherit eutils toolchain-funcs java-pkg-2 java-ant-2 @@ -23,24 +25,18 @@ SRC_URI="http://sbriesen.de/gentoo/distfiles/${MY_PN}_Source_${PV}.tbz2 LICENSE="GPL-2" SLOT="0" KEYWORDS="~amd64 ~ppc ~ppc64 ~x86" -IUSE="X doc source mmx java5 java6" +IUSE="X mmx" COMMON_DEP="dev-java/commons-net X? ( =dev-java/browserlauncher2-1* )" -RDEPEND="java6? ( >=virtual/jre-1.6 ) - !java6? ( java5? ( >=virtual/jre-1.5 ) ) - !java6? ( !java5? ( >=virtual/jre-1.4 ) ) +RDEPEND=">=virtual/jre-1.5 ${COMMON_DEP}" -DEPEND="java6? ( >=virtual/jdk-1.6 ) - !java6? ( java5? ( >=virtual/jdk-1.5 ) ) - !java6? ( !java5? ( >=virtual/jdk-1.4 ) ) +DEPEND=">=virtual/jdk-1.5 ${COMMON_DEP} app-arch/unzip - >=sys-apps/sed-4 - dev-java/ant-core - source? ( app-arch/zip )" + >=sys-apps/sed-4" S="${WORKDIR}/${MY_P}" @@ -54,15 +50,7 @@ src_unpack() { cd "${S}" # copy build.xml - if use java6; then - sed 's:\(value=\"\)1\.4\(\"\):\11.6\2:g' \ - "${FILESDIR}/build-${PV%.*}.xml" > build.xml - elif use java5; then - sed 's:\(value=\"\)1\.4\(\"\):\11.5\2:g' \ - "${FILESDIR}/build-${PV%.*}.xml" > build.xml - else - cp -f "${FILESDIR}/build-${PV%.*}.xml" build.xml - fi + cp -f "${FILESDIR}/build-${PV%.*}.xml" build.xml || die # patch location of executable sed -i -e "s:^\(Exec=\).*:\1${PN}:g" *.desktop diff --git a/media-video/projectx/projectx-0.90.4.00_p32.ebuild b/media-video/projectx/projectx-0.90.4.00_p32.ebuild index 6cab1553924b..4dbbf388a9d4 100644 --- a/media-video/projectx/projectx-0.90.4.00_p32.ebuild +++ b/media-video/projectx/projectx-0.90.4.00_p32.ebuild @@ -1,9 +1,11 @@ -# Copyright 1999-2009 Gentoo Foundation +# Copyright 1999-2010 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-video/projectx/projectx-0.90.4.00_p32.ebuild,v 1.1 2009/10/08 18:29:21 billie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-video/projectx/projectx-0.90.4.00_p32.ebuild,v 1.2 2010/02/11 23:03:14 caster Exp $ EAPI="2" +JAVA_PKG_IUSE="doc source" + inherit eutils toolchain-funcs java-pkg-2 java-ant-2 MY_PN="ProjectX" @@ -25,21 +27,16 @@ SRC_URI="mirror://gentoo/${MY_PN}_Source_${PV}.tbz2 LICENSE="GPL-2" SLOT="0" KEYWORDS="~amd64 ~ppc ~ppc64 ~x86" -IUSE="X doc source mmx java5 java6" +IUSE="X mmx" COMMON_DEP="dev-java/commons-net X? ( =dev-java/browserlauncher2-1* )" -RDEPEND="java6? ( >=virtual/jre-1.6 ) - !java6? ( java5? ( >=virtual/jre-1.5 ) ) - !java6? ( !java5? ( >=virtual/jre-1.4 ) ) +RDEPEND=">=virtual/jre-1.5 ${COMMON_DEP}" -DEPEND="java6? ( >=virtual/jdk-1.6 ) - !java6? ( java5? ( >=virtual/jdk-1.5 ) ) - !java6? ( !java5? ( >=virtual/jdk-1.4 ) ) - ${COMMON_DEP} - source? ( app-arch/zip )" +DEPEND=">=virtual/jdk-1.5 + ${COMMON_DEP}" S="${WORKDIR}/${MY_P}" @@ -48,17 +45,9 @@ mainclass() { sed -n "s/^Main-Class: \([^ ]\+\).*/\1/p" "${S}/MANIFEST.MF" } -src_prepare() { +java_prepare() { # copy build.xml - if use java6; then - sed 's:\(value=\"\)1\.4\(\"\):\11.6\2:g' \ - "${FILESDIR}/build-${PV%.*}.xml" > build.xml - elif use java5; then - sed 's:\(value=\"\)1\.4\(\"\):\11.5\2:g' \ - "${FILESDIR}/build-${PV%.*}.xml" > build.xml - else - cp -f "${FILESDIR}/build-${PV%.*}.xml" build.xml - fi + cp -f "${FILESDIR}/build-${PV%.*}.xml" build.xml || die # patch location of executable sed -i -e "s:^\(Exec=\).*:\1${PN}:g" *.desktop |